## Deploying the Gatewick Proctor Queue

Deploys are pretty painless: push to main, wait for the pipeline, then watch the queue drain dashboard for five minutes. If candidates pile up mid-exam, roll back first and ask questions later — the queue replays safely. Everything the workers care about lives in one config block, shown here for reference.

settings of bafof-yagef:
JOROX_PIN=8740
JOROX_TENANT=pelox
JOROX_METRICS_HOST=metrics.jorox.qorvelworks.internal
JOROX_SEAL=seal_c78f63c1
JOROX_STANDBY_TEAM=norax

- [ ] Before we sign the import bundle for the Marlowe Library catalogue sync, double-check the MARC field mappings one last time — reviewer eyes appreciated here. Once the checksum matches what Priya posted, the signing key escrow gets sealed. If the escrow ever needs reopening, you'll want the recovery passphrase, which is noted directly below for the ceremony record.

vault phrase of hahop-badug = novvan-ulaion-zorius-noviel-gorwyn-casix-tamys

## v4.2.0 — Changed defaults

The nightly search reindex in Marrowlight Search now runs with incremental mode on by default and full rebuilds limited to Sundays. Index snapshots are encrypted at rest by default; the previous opt-in flag is removed. Security reviewers should note the tightened scheduler permissions. The new default configuration shipped with this release follows below.

deployment values, tafof-taduf:
pelius:
  pin: 6508
  tenant: praiel
  seal: seal_4e33a2f4
  metrics_host: metrics.pelius.plorvagrid.corp
  standby_team: druix
  escalation: juldor-norius
  nonce: 5db598

Finance Review Summary — Training Budget

Next year's training allocation for Quellan Systems is proposed at a 12% increase, driven by the certification push in the Ferndale office. Underspend this year was 9%, mainly deferred workshops. Finance should earmark contingency for external facilitators. The rationale for the uplift is set out in the note below.

internal memo for kaduf-baduf: Only 35 of the 378 pilot accounts renewed Holir, so a churn review is set for June 11. Eliielax Group is in early talks to buy Silaelix Group for about $142.1 million.